Silverpoint is a traditional drawing technique that was used by such artists as Leonardo da Vinci, Albrecht Dürer and Rembrandt. An ancient art form that is experiencing a revival, silverpoint is accomplished by using a silver stylus on prepared paper to produce a fine delicate drawing. The silver-gray drawing tarnishes when exposed to air, resulting in a pleasing, golden brown tone.
